Default 2013 GS TC does not work

When I push the TC button nothing happens, no display, no action. I push the button when the car is in motion. When starting the car it goes through the system check and shows all is good. The car has 10,000 miles on it and does not show any service soon messages. I wonder if I should turn the TC off before I drive off.
